Add the split peas to a pot with your preferred cooking liquid—water, vegetable broth, and bone broth are all good options. Bring to a boil over high heat, stir, then reduce heat, cover, and simmer until the split peas are tender but not mushy and most of the liquid is absorbed. It should take about 20 minutes.

Rinse 1 cup of dried green whole peas under cold water to remove discolored peas or debris. Soak the whole peas in a bowl of cold water for 6 to 8 hours or overnight. Drain the water. Add the peas to a saucepan filled with 3 cups of fresh water. Bring the water to a boil and simmer for 40 to 55 minutes or until tender.

Major Nutrients. You'll get about 115 calories from 1/2 cup of split dried green peas, according to the U.S. Department of Agriculture. Right around 70 percent of the calories in dried peas - or about 21 grams for a 1/2-cup serving - come from carbohydrates. Cooking time: Split peas, 30-60 minutes; whole peas, 60-90 minutes. Liquid per cup of legume: Split peas, 4 cups; whole peas, 6 cups. How to cook dried peas: While dried split peas do not need to be soaked, dried whole peas should be soaked overnight prior to cooking. For split peas, combine in a pot with fresh, cold water for cooking.

Boiling the Peas. If boiling is your preferred cooking method, bring two quarts of water per cup of dried green peas to a boil over high heat. Add the peas and stir, before allowing the water to return to a full boil. Reduce the heat to low, cover the pan with a lid, and boil for 15-20 minutes or until the peas are tender.

1 cup of dried peas. 3 cups of water or broth. Salt and seasonings to taste. To cook on the stovetop: In a large pot, combine the soaked or unsoaked peas, water or broth, and any desired seasonings. Bring to a boil, then reduce the heat, cover, and simmer for about 1 to 1 œ hours. Stir occasionally. Check for doneness.
